Why Aluminum is Ideal for Motor Parts?

  • Perfect for CNC-Machined Motor Parts
  • Excellent Machinability
    Soft yet stable, ideal for precise turning and milling of motor bases and covers.

  • High Strength-to-Weight Ratio
    Ensures durable yet lightweight drone frames and structural parts.

  • Superior Heat Dissipation
    Great thermal conductivity for motor covers and electronic enclosures.

  • Corrosion Resistance
    Long-lasting performance in outdoor or high-altitude drone environments.

  • Supports Custom CNC Machining and Requirements
    Compatible with complex shapes, tight tolerances, and anodized finishes.

MaterialKey FeaturesApplications
6061-T6Versatile, strong, corrosion-resistantGeneral components, brackets
7075-T6Very high strength, aerospace-gradeDrone frames, structural parts
2024Fatigue-resistant, excellent toughnessAerospace, automotive
5052 / 5083Weldable, marine-grade corrosion resistanceMarine parts, panels
